Posted at: 12 June

Platform Engineer - Cloud Security Automation

Company

GuidePoint Security

GuidePoint Security is a Herndon, Virginia-based B2B cybersecurity consulting firm specializing in tailored security solutions, incident response, and compliance services for commercial and federal organizations.

Remote Hiring Policy:

GuidePoint Security supports remote work and primarily hires from the U.S., with roles available in various regions including the Mid-Atlantic. Most remote positions are limited to U.S.-based candidates.

Job Type

Full-time

Allowed Applicant Locations

United States

Job Description

GuidePoint is seeking a Platform Engineer to join our Cloud Security Automation Team, focusing on building scalable, secure platforms and data infrastructure for multiple client-facing solutions. This role combines platform engineering expertise with full-stack development to architect and implement robust automation systems, security analytics platforms, and custom solutions that serve our team's diverse client portfolio and internal operational needs

Roles and Responsibilities:

  • Multi-Client Platform Development. Design and build scalable, secure platform architectures that support various client solutions, including our flagship SaaS Security Intelligence Platform and other custom automation tools.

  • Infrastructure as Code. Implement and maintain cloud infrastructure using Terraform, AWS CloudFormation, and other IaC tools to ensure consistent, reproducible deployments across multiple client environments.

  • Microservices Architecture. Develop containerized microservices using Docker and orchestration platforms, ensuring high availability, scalability, and fault tolerance across client platforms.

  • API Development & Integration. Build robust RESTful APIs and integrate with third-party security tools, cloud services, and client-specific systems to enable seamless data flow and automation workflows.

  • Platform Security. Implement security best practices throughout the platform stack, including authentication, authorization, encryption, and compliance requirements for multi-tenant environments.

  • Data Pipeline Architecture. Design and maintain scalable ETL/ELT pipelines that process diverse data sources including security logs, cloud metrics, automation workflows, and client-specific datasets.

  • Real-Time Processing. Implement stream processing solutions using AWS Kinesis, Apache Kafka, or similar technologies to handle high-volume, real-time data ingestion and processing.

  • Database Design & Optimization. Architect and optimize database schemas across PostgreSQL, MongoDB, and other data stores to support complex queries and analytics workloads.

  • Backend Services: Develop high-performance backend services to support platform functionality and client-specific requirements.

  • Frontend Integration. Build responsive web interfaces when needed to support platform administration, monitoring dashboards, and client portals.

  • Cloud Platform Expertise. 3+ years of hands-on experience with AWS services (EC2, Lambda, S3, RDS, EKS, etc.) and cloud-native architecture patterns

  • Programming Proficiency. Strong experience with Python, JavaScript/TypeScript, and at least one additional language; experience with frameworks like Django, FastAPI, React, or Node.js

  • Infrastructure & DevOps. Proven experience with Infrastructure as Code (Terraform, CloudFormation), containerization (Docker, Kubernetes), and CI/CD pipelines

  • Database Management. Experience with both relational (PostgreSQL, MySQL) and NoSQL (MongoDB, DynamoDB) databases, including schema design and query optimization

  • API Development. Strong background in building and consuming RESTful APIs, with understanding of authentication, rate limiting, and API security best practices

Requirements:

  • Hands-on experience with AI tools, infrastructure-as-code, CI/CD pipeline management, and cloud IaaS/PaaS implementation.

  • Strong skills in documentation, structured writing, and process mapping.

  • Comfortable working across technical and non-technical teams.

  • Familiarity with cloud platforms (AWS, Azure, or GCP) and/or security services is a plus.

  • Ability to work independently and collaboratively with technical teams.